You didn't mention how many OS upgrades you've done on these systems. diana On April 7, 2024 3:04:53 PM MDT, Glen Gunsalus <g-gunsa...@mindspring.com> wrote: I have been running OpenBSD on three apu2 boards (as firewalls) for several years and doing remote (ssh to boards) with no problems. Doing the 7.4 to 7.5 upgrades I had an initial success then two failures. Not confidence building since these firewalls are at remote sites. Not sure where the problem lies, here is what I've experienced: pcEngines apu2 boards, running sysupgrade - have been running OpenBSD since about 6.2 and doing remote (ssh to board) for several releases w/o any problems Did successful sysupgrade on one board the evening before 7.5 release notification using: url https://cdn.openbsd.org/pub/OpenBSD/ <https://cdn.openbsd.org/pub/OpenBSD/> (other mirrors not yet showing items in 7.5 directory) Went fine, as per norm. Next day did on a second board using my default url (as per all previous remote upgrades) https://mirrors.sonic.net/pub/OpenBSD/ <https://mirrors.sonic.net/pub/OpenBSD/> after syspugrade pings ok but cannot ssh: ssh: connect to host 10.42.xx.xx port 22: Connection refused used minicom to hook up to serial port and was able to see (didn't require login??): # ls -al total 166 drwxr-xr-x 11 root wheel 512 Apr 7 18:34 . drwxr-xr-x 11 root wheel 512 Apr 7 18:34 .. -rw-r--r-- 1 root wheel 1770 Mar 20 21:53 .profile -rw-r--r-- 1 root wheel 194 Apr 7 18:34 auto_upgrade.conf lrwxr-xr-x 1 root wheel 11 Mar 20 21:53 autoinstall -> install.sub drwxr-xr-x 2 root wheel 512 Mar 20 21:53 bin drwxr-xr-x 2 root wheel 2560 Apr 7 18:34 dev drwxr-xr-x 5 root wheel 512 Apr 7 18:34 etc lrwxr-xr-x 1 root wheel 11 Mar 20 21:53 install -> install.sub -rw-r--r-- 1 root wheel 2903 Mar 20 21:53 install.md -rwxr-xr-x 1 root wheel 64483 Mar 20 21:53 install.sub drwxr-xr-x 15 root wheel 512 Apr 7 18:36 mnt drwxr-xr-x 2 root wheel 512 Mar 20 21:53 mnt2 drwxr-xr-x 2 root wheel 1024 Mar 20 21:53 sbin drwxrwxrwt 4 root wheel 512 Apr 7 18:36 tmp lrwxr-xr-x 1 root wheel 11 Mar 20 21:53 upgrade -> install.sub drwxr-xr-x 6 root wheel 512 Mar 20 21:53 usr drwxr-xr-x 6 root wheel 512 Mar 20 21:53 var reboot from serial console with minicom Comes back up (can ssh now) but with only one cpu (normally running mp - cpu[0-3] ) reboot Watching on serial port reorder_kernel: failed -- see /usr/share/relink/kernel/GENERIC/relink.log as per log: run 'sha256 -h /var/db/kernel.SHA256 /bsd' reboot, no error, but still in single cpu mode. reboot bsd.mp hang, ssh connection refused Power cycle to get fresh reboot but still hangs still on serial port: boot usb with miniroot75.img reboot - needed to reset - 'stty com0 115200; set tty com0', otherwise hangs Choose upgrade Success! This happened on a third apu2 board; thus, two unsucessful and one successful sysupgrades on apu2 boards Any ideas/pointers? I'd like this not to reoccur.
